Sony Vaio Z rumored to get “Quad SSD” storage

By Brian - 01/04/2010 5:50:07 PM


Sony’s stylish high-end laptops, the Vaio Z series, is rumored to be getting some rather speedy SSD options. There’s talk of four SSDs in a RAID-0 configuration, which should give blistering speeds. RAID-0 splits data between two drives, giving more speed and performance, but if one drive fails, all data is lost. Sony hasn’t released any details or actual performance stats of the new setup, but expect lots of coverage at CES.
